18. Which of the following is a complex sentence? A. I would like to visit the Kinshasa, but I understand the city is unsafe for

foreigners. B. Check out the editorial page in today's paper and you'll notice the piece by George Will. C. As Jake was reading the email from June yet again, the flight attendant coughed gently to get his attention. D. I simply cannot make heads or tails of rap lyrics, but I suppose I'm just too old to understand them.
English
2 answers:
SSSSS [86.1K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er is C. As Jake was reading the email from June yet again, the flight attendant coughed gently to get his attention. This is an example for a Complex Sentence.

Remember, <u>affixes</u> simply refers to words that are attached to a word (add the beginning or end of the word) to form a new word or word form.

<u>Find five examples of such words in a sentence are:</u>

  1. "Because of the temperature, the pot was<u> untouchable."</u> We notice here that the word was formed from the word <u>touch;</u> by adding 'un' at the beginning and 'able' to the end we form the word 'untouchable'.
  2. "They were<u> unbeatable</u> for the whole season." We can notice here that the word was formed from the word <u>beat;</u> by adding 'un' at the beginning and 'able' to the end we form the word 'unbeatable'.
  3. "There is a lot of <u>misinformation</u> about the pandemic." We observe here that the word was formed from the word <u>information;</u> by adding 'mis' at the beginning we form the word 'misinformation'.
  4. "I <u>successfully</u> wrote my exams." We also observe here that the word was formed from the word <u>success;</u> by adding 'fully' at the end which forms the word 'successfully'.
  5. "He feels <u>joyful</u> today." We observe that the word was formed from the word <u>joy;</u> by adding 'ful' at the end which forms the word 'joyful'.
